목록Git & GitHub (6)
wintertreey 님의 블로그
원격 develop-1 로컬 develop-1 기능브랜치들(login, review, fleamarket etc) 1. 최신원격develop-1 > pull> 현로컬develop-1 2. 새로운 기능 작업명 브랜치 생성 ex) login 3. 기능작업완료 후 최신원격develop-1 > pull > 현로컬develop-1 4. 로컬 login > merge > 최신반영된 로컬develop-1 > push > 원격 develop-1 ------- 1. 최신 원격 develop-1을 로컬 develop-1으로 pull 원격 저장소의 최신 변경 사항을 로컬 develop-1 브랜치로 가져옵니다. 이를 통해 로컬 브랜치가 최신 상태로 유지됩니다. git checkout develop-1 git pull ..
요점 : 무조건 작업물 백업해두고 깃배시 작업하기. 예시 브랜치 명 메인 브랜치 (main): 배포 가능한 안정된 상태를 유지합니다.개발 브랜치 (develop): 모든 팀원의 작업이 통합되는 브랜치입니다.개인 브랜치 (apple, bana, cat, 등): 각 팀원이 독립적으로 작업하는 브랜치입니다. 작업 흐름1. 개인 브랜치에서 작업하기git checkout apple 작업 후 커밋git add .git commit -m "작업내용설명" 원격저장소에 푸시하기git push origin apple 2. develop 브랜치에 통합된 결과물 받기개인 브랜치 (apple)에서 작업을 완료하고, 해당 브랜치의 작업 내용을 커밋하고 원격 저장소에 푸시한 상태입니다.이 시점에서 apple 브랜치의 로컬 저장..
Git 이란 분산형 버젼 관리 시스템의 한 종류이며, 빠른 수행 속도에 중점을 둔다. 버젼관리 시스템파일의 변화를 시간에 따라 기록했다가 나중에 특정시점의 버젼을 다시 꺼내올 수 있는 시스템. - 각 파일 혹은 프로젝트 통째로 이전 상태로 되돌릴 수 있다.- 시간에 따라 수정 내용 비교가 가능하다.- 파일을 잃어버리거나 잘못 고쳤을때도 쉽게 복구할 수 있다.- 누가, 언제 문제를 일으켰는지 쉽게 추적할 수 있다. Git 의 장점소스 코드를 주고 받을 필요 없이, 같은 파일을 여러 명이 동시에 작업하는 병렬 개발이 가능하다.(브랜치를 통해 개발한 뒤, 본 프로그램에서 합치는 방식(Merge)으로 개발을 진행할 수 있다.)분산 버전 관리이기 때문에 인터넷이 연결되지 않은 곳에서도 개발을 진행할 수 있고,..
깃허브에서 개인브랜치 생성하기 로컬작업공간(노트북, 컴퓨터)에서 깃허브 레퍼지토리 세팅하기 프로젝트 작업공간으로 새로운 폴더 생성하기.해당 작업공간 폴더에 들어와 깃 배시 열기 git initGit 초기화깃 시작 명령어 git clone https://github.com/username/repository.git 깃허브에 만들어진 폴더 그자체와 브랜치들이 다 들어온다. 개인브랜치 생성같은 작업을 할 필요가 없다. 혹은 세부적으로 작업해주고 싶다면... 하단의 remote~~ 부터 명령어들을 적어주면 된다. (($ git remote add origin https://github.com/username/repository.git 원격 저장소 추가레퍼지토리 주소 연결 우리 팀 프로젝트의 단계별 깃..
초반 세팅 # 2. 로컬 저장소 초기화 git init # 3. 변경 사항 스테이징 git add . # 4. 커밋 생성 git commit -m "Initial commit" # 5. 원격 저장소 추가 git remote add origin https://github.com/username/repository.git # 6. 브랜치 설정 (optional, 만약 main 브랜치를 기본 브랜치로 사용한다면) git branch -M main # 7. 변경 사항 푸시 git push -u origin main 추가 업로드시 $ git add . $ git commit -m "---" $ git push origin main https://blog.naver.com/comma_dev/223530523026 ..
Git Bash로 작업공간에서 업로드시 에러가 났다. fatal : unable to access 하얀색이 내 정보, 노란색이 구사용자정보. 자리를 옮기고 나서 깃배시연동시 에러문구가 떴다. 전사용자의 깃허브 계정정보가 남아있어서 거부되었던것. 편집버튼을 눌러 수정하면 된다. https://breakcoding.tistory.com/61 [GitHub] 깃허브 fatal: unable to access, push 안 됨학교 연구실 PC에서 작업하던 것을 집에서도 이어서 하고 싶어서 집에 와서 내 노트북에 내 레파지토리를 clone해왔다. 그러고 나서 코드를 수정하고 add와 commit까지는 잘 했다. 그런데 push가 안 되breakcoding.tistory.com